21 Sweet + Savory Peach Recipes to Make Before Summer Ends (2024)

If you’ve taken a trip to the farmers’ market or grocery store produce section recently, then you probably noticed the piles of peaches everywhere. And who could complain, really? Those light orange beauties are the highlight of summer and, surprisingly to some, are an extremely versatile fruit that can jump from sweet to savory dishes like nobody’s business. Keep reading for 21 recipes that take full advantage of peach season.

1. Red Cabbage Wraps: Here, diced turkey breast is stir-fried with peaches and brown rice, topped with a tomato/cucumber/corn salsa and rolled into a crunchy red cabbage leaf. Wrap ’em up for a meal that is light, refreshing and good to the very last bite. (via Dish Tales)

2. Grilled Peach Crostini: Step up your crostini game with layers of goat cheese, arugula, prosciutto, grilled peaches and a balsamic reduction sauce. This is one appetizer that sets a high standard right from the start. (via Spoonful of Flavor)

3. Bourbon Honey Peach Galette: The freshly sliced peaches here are dipped in bourbon and honey before taking center stage on a flaky buttermilk pie dough that’s surrounded by a ring of raw sugar. Serve with vanilla bean ice cream and watch the whole thing magically disappear. (via Butterlust)

4. Peach + Prosciutto Caprese Salad: This fruity take on a caprese salad is a delicious option for days when the last thing you want to do is turn on the oven. And the best part? You’ll go from fridge to table in only five minutes. (via My Bottomless Boyfriend)

5. Gorgonzola Peach Bacon Flatbread: Personal pizza like you’ve never seen it before: Smokey bacon, crumbled gorgonzola and thin-sliced peaches are baked on naan until crispy and gussied up with arugula and balsamic dressing. We’ll take two, please! (via A Side of Sweet)

6. Peach French Toast: Perfect for weekends when you have company staying over, this french toast is prepared the night before. Slip it in the oven and go enjoy a cup of coffee with your guests. (via Well Plated)

7. Peach BBQ Sliders: Pull out your crock pot and whip up a batch of this peach pulled pork with just three ingredients. Prep it the night before and you’ll come home after a long day to a tasty (and stress-free) dinner. (via Eat At Home)

8. Caramelized Peach Ice Cream: You don’t need a fancy ice cream maker to perfect this creamy confection full of peaches simmered in butter, cinnamon and sugar. Just be sure you make enough to go around, because no one’s going to turn this down. (via Ciao Chow Bambina)

9. Peach Pecan Pancakes: Start your day off with a stack of maple-syrup-drenched buttermilk pancakes with peach puree folded into the batter. They’re actually a proven cure for a case of the Mondays. (via Buns in My Oven)

10. Roasted Peach Pavlov: Impress all your friends with sweet meringue shells filled with mascarpone cheese and caramelized peaches. No one needs to know just how easy it was to put together. (via Sweet Si Bon)

11. Bacon, Lettuce and Grilled Peach Sandwich: Move over, BLT. The BLP is here to stay. (via Betsy Life)

12. Dessert Peach Pizza: Enjoy your entire meal al fresco from start to finish with a dessert pizza that cooks entirely on the grill. Drizzle with powdered sugar icing right before serving and make someone else do all those dishes. (via Julie Blanner)

14. Peaches ‘n’ Cream Bars: An easy and crowd-pleasing recipe, these bars make ripe peaches the star of the show among an all-star cast of rolled oats, cinnamon and pecans. (via Sally’s Baking Addiction)

15. Peachy Quinoa and Arugula Salad: Tired of your regular salad? Toss in some quinoa, sliced peaches and a handful of chopped walnuts for a lunch that is anything but ordinary. (via One Ingredient Chef)

16. Chipotle Peach BBQ Ribs: Licking BBQ sauce off your fingers as you devour meat straight off the grill is what summertime’s all about, and this chipotle-peach version is no exception. (via The Beeroness)

17. Grilled Peach, Corn and Avocado Chicken Salad: This tangy Greek yogurt and lime dressing is so simple to make, and it only has five ingredients. Once you taste it, you’ll want to put it on everything. (via Ricotta and Radishes)

18. Peach Summer Rolls: These rolls require absolutely zero cooking and pack a ton of flavor in every bite. If that’s not a winning recipe, we don’t know what is. (via Lazy Cat Kitchen)

19. Peach Greek Yogurt Pops: Cool down on those hot summer afternoons with a delicious frozen treat. Don’t have fancy molds? A paper cup and popsicle stick will work just as well. (via The Foodie Corner)

20. Mango Peach Salsa: The perfect combination of spicy and sweet, this salsa is so good you’ll never buy the jarred stuff again. (via My Bottomless Boyfriend)

21. Cinnamon Roll Peach Turnover: You might start out with a can of cinnamon roll dough and peaches, but in less than 30 minutes you’ll have soft, rustic turnovers that look like they took all afternoon to make. (via Lemons for Lulu)

What spices enhance peaches? ›

Ginger, cinnamon, cardamom, clove and nutmeg give warmth and gentle spice to peaches, while herbs like basil, tarragon, thyme and rosemary add earthy notes to peach desserts.

Why do you boil peaches? ›

Blanching peaches loosens their skin and makes them super easy to peel. The heat helps separate the skin from the peaches so the peels slip off, rather than being needed to be cut off. Put the peaches in the boiling water, making sure they are entirely submerged. Blanch them for 40 seconds.

How many pounds is a bushel of peaches? ›

Peaches Bushel 48 - 52 lbs. Peck 12 - 14 lbs.

What is a harvester peach? ›

The typical Harvester peach tree has green leaves with white and pink blossoms. When the blossoms are fertilized, they bear fruit that's two to three inches in diameter. The peaches have a mix of yellow-reddish color on its fuzzy skin with yellow, juicy flesh on the inside.
